How to charge a lead-acid battery?

The batteries should be charged in a well-ventilated place so that gases and acid fumes are blown away. The lead-acid battery should never be left idle for a long time in discharged condition because the lead sulfate coating on both the positive and negative plates will form into hard crystals that will be difficult to break up on recharging.

Can a lead acid battery charger be plugged in over a weekend?

Seek out new charger technology: Older lead acid battery chargers require careful monitoring to avoid “over-charging.” But new charger technology allows the batteries and charger to be plugged in over a weekend or longer. The charger will shut off once the full charge on batteries is reached.

How to extend the life of a sealed lead acid battery?

You can extend the life of your sealed lead acid battery if you are careful about charging it. More batteries are damaged by bad charging techniques than from all other causes. Check the manufacturer’s recommendation for charging and use the proper charger for the battery.
